The Ewing Township Teacher’s Association donated $5,000 to the 2017 Ewing High School post prom event.

The post prom event is held every year at the high school from 11 p.m. to 4 a.m. after the prom, and the goal of the event is to provide a fun, safe and alcohol and drug free environment for students to celebrate their graduation. The night often includes games, live music, food and other activities.

The parents of each graduating class spend four years fundraising for the event. The Ewing Township Teacher’s Association donated the $5,000 to help the 2017 Parent Group reach their fundraising goal.
